Site Superintendent – Fort St John
WCPG Construction Ltd is currently looking for a Site Superintendent for a project located in Fort St John, BC starting in late March 2024. WCPG Construction Ltd is a rapidly expanding multi-family property development and construction company with projects throughout British Columbia. The ideal candidate will have a minimum of five years of experience as a Site Superintendent on multifamily, wood frame developments ranging in size from 50-100 units with excellent communication skills and wood frame build outs. Key job responsibilities include: Creating a project schedule, working closely with the project manager, coordinating and scheduling sub- trades.
You will work and communicate directly with our subcontractors, suppliers and staff. You must have great communication skills, knowledge of the building process from start to finish, maintain the ability to prioritize/multi-task, and have strong problem solving skills.

Responsibilities
The Site Superintendent provides leadership and is responsible for, although not limited to:
- Maintaining Schedules and Budget
- Supervising & leadership
- Ensuring the safety of crew members
- Following site safety guidelines
- Productivity of crew members & quality control
- Collaborate with the Project Manager to identify and coordinate items with long lead times.
- Communicate any existing damage or deficiencies to the key players.
- Monitor and control project quality.
- Completely understand the scope of work, and notify the Project Manager and Vice President of any “Extras” or change orders.
- Coordinate and schedule sub-trades and subcontractors.
- Adhere to and accelerate project timelines and materials.
- Manage/set the pace of production to ensure timely execution
- Ensure completion of deficiency items and communicate with the Project Management team.
